WATTLETON v. INTERN. BROTH. OF BOILER MAKERS, ETC.

No. 81-2411.

686 F.2d 586 (1982)

William WATTLETON, et al., Plaintiffs-Appellees, and Steve T. Tillman, et al., Plaintiffs-Intervenors-Appellees, v. The INTERNATIONAL BROTHERHOOD OF BOILER MAKERS, IRON SHIP BUILDERS, BLACKSMITHS, FORGERS AND HELPERS, LOCAL # 1509, Defendant-Appellant.

United States Court of Appeals, Seventh Circuit.

Decided August 16, 1982.

Rehearing and Rehearing Denied September 27, 1982.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

John A. Udovc, Milwaukee, Wis., for defendant-appellant.

Jonathan Wallas, Charlotte, N. C., for plaintiffs-appellees.

Before CUMMINGS, Chief Judge, POSNER, Circuit Judge, and LEIGHTON, District Judge.


Rehearing and Rehearing En Banc Denied September 27, 1982.

LEIGHTON, District Judge.

In this appeal by a local union of blacksmiths, we are asked to resolve two issues. First, whether the district court's findings of fact concerning the seniority system contained in the union's collective bargaining agreements with the Ladish Company of Cudahy, Wisconsin are clearly erroneous.
